CBK Honors Banks for Outstanding Awareness and Education Efforts in 2024
The Governor of the Central Bank of Kuwait (CBK), Basel A. Al-Haroon, honored Kuwaiti banks for their outstanding performance in supporting the banking awareness campaign "Diraya” launched by CBK in collaboration with Kuwait Banking Association (KBA). These banks harnessed their full capabilities to engage with customers through digital channels and social media platforms, while also organizing initiatives tailored to diverse segments of society. Their efforts aimed to maximize the campaign’s outreach and promote public awareness on a broad spectrum of financial and banking topics.
In a statement by the Governor, he praised the exemplary efforts of Kuwait Finance House, the National Bank of Kuwait, the Al Ahli Bank of Kuwait, and the Kuwait International Bank. He also commended the level of interaction with, and response to, the campaign by all Kuwaiti banks, adding that the efforts made by all the banks contributed to the success of the campaign and delivering its messages to the widest segment of banking sector customers.
The Governor concluded by affirming that it spares no effort to spread financial and banking awareness and protect customers' rights in light of the development of banking services and associated risks, most notably electronic fraud and its various techniques that call for continuous awareness and expanding the role of Kuwaiti banking sector in social responsibility.
It's worth noting that the campaign utilizes a variety of tools and channels, including awareness videos, press releases, and informational materials across all communication channels, particularly digital channels, social media accounts of CBK, Kuwaiti banks, and KBA, as well as bank branches and other public-facing outlets. This comprehensive approach ensures the campaign's message is widely disseminated and engaged with by the public.
